There is insufficient information to determine how long chrysin has been used in pharmacy compounding. Chrysin is used as an ingredient in dietary supplements, but there is no information on systemic exposure from topical application. As of 2016, there was no evidence to support any effect of oral chrysin on testosterone levels, or an any disease-modifying activity with oral or topical formulations.
